Should we focus on our goal,or on the process?
What happened to Brenda Martinez,a US Olympic runner,may provide us with the answer.
She lost her balance in the 800m race and failed to qualify for the Olympics.Focusing on
everything that would give her another chance,she quickly let go of what happened in the 800m
race and got back to her routine.A week later,she won the third place in the 1500m race to
qualify for the Olympics in Rio.Instead of attaching herself to the goal of making the Olympic
team,she concentrated on the process.
Generally,overemphasizing goals based on ultimate outcomes often leads to risk-taking,
unethical(不道德的)behavior and reduced motivation.We see this happen in the real world all
the time:someone becomes driven by the external rewards and recognition that he hopes
accomplishing his goal will bring,and,in the worst case,he'll go to any extreme to achieve it
such as taking harmful diet pills to lose weight or using banned drugs in a competition.These
are all predictable side effects of overemphasizing goals.
Another danger of only focusing on goals is giving up all the merits after completing them.
For example,some marathon runners experience what's called the "post-race blues".Achieving
their goal may cause them to drop the good habits that got them there.Dieters often experience
this in what's called "yo-yo dieting"-gaining all the weight back while resuming their bad
habits after they drop down to a desired weight.
However,focusing on the process will help you to achieve little victories on your way to
achieving long-term goals and leave you with a sense of satisfaction and accomplishment,
期中学情调研
高一年级英语学科
第7页共12页
regardless of the ultimate outcome.It means breaking down a goal into little parts and
concentrating on those parts.For Martinez,this meant not worrying about her bad luck in the
800m race,but rather ensuring she got in the right nutrition,sleep and workouts to give herself
the best chance to run a good race in the 1500m race.
Therefore,after you set a goal,it's best to shift your focus from the goal itself to the process
that gives you the best chance of achieving the goal,and to judge yourself based on how well
you do in the process.

This year marks the centenary of the Palace Museum,an important occasion that celebrates
its transformation from an imperial fortress into a world-renowned sign of culture and history.
Over the past century,it has not only kept China's glorious past but has also dynamically
reinvented itself for a global audience.
The museum's journey began in 1925,following the expulsion of the last emperor.The
once-forbidden gates were opened to the public,turning a symbol of supreme power into a shared
treasure for all.The early years were filled with immense challenges.The most notable was the
"Southern Migration"of its artifacts,a heroic and hard effort to protect over 13,000 crates of
precious treasures from the damages of war,ensuring their survival for future generations.
In recent decades,the Palace Museum has masterfully balanced preservation with
